[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#827136: marked as done (Cross-compiler packages cannot be build-depended on)



Your message dated Tue, 13 Dec 2016 16:08:37 +0000
with message-id <1481645317.2742.44.camel@decadent.org.uk>
and subject line Re: Bug#827136: fixed in gcc-5-cross 24
has caused the Debian Bug report #827136,
regarding Cross-compiler packages cannot be build-depended on
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
827136: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=827136
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: src:gcc-5-cross
Version: 23
Severity: normal

I am looking into making the linux source package cross-buildable in a
standard way.  This requires replacing a build-dependency of e.g.:

    gcc-5 [...] <!stage1>

with:

    gcc-5 [...] <!stage1 !cross>, gcc-5-alpha-linux-gnu:any [alpha] <!stage1 cross>, ...

Unfortunately this is still unsatisfiable since the cross-compiler
packages have 'Multi-Arch: no'.  Please change this to 'Multi-Arch:
allowed'.

Ben.

-- System Information:
Debian Release: stretch/sid
  APT prefers stable-updates
  APT policy: (500, 'stable-updates'), (500, 'unstable'), (500, 'stable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 4.6.0-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

--- End Message ---
--- Begin Message ---
Version: 24

On Thu, 14 Jul 2016 13:30:07 +0100 Ben Hutchings <ben@decadent.org.uk> wrote:
> Control: reopen -1
> Control: notfixed -1 24
> 
> On Thu, 14 Jul 2016 09:51:35 +0300 Александр Волков
> <a.volkov@rusbitech.ru> wrote:
> > It's still not fixed in gcc-5-cross-24.
> > There is the entry about fixes in the changelog, but there are no fixes 
> > in the control files.
> 
> Indeed, this wasn't fixed.

The real fix was in gcc-5.  gcc-5-cross replaces at least some control
fields from information in the gcc-5-source package.  So rebuilding
against a newer gcc-5-source really did fix this bug.

Ben.

-- 
Ben Hutchings
One of the nice things about standards is that there are so many of
them.

Attachment: signature.asc
Description: This is a digitally signed message part


--- End Message ---

Reply to: